Importance of Proper Blood Sample Handling and Storage

Proper handling and storage of blood samples are crucial for several reasons:

  1. Accuracy of Test Results: Improper handling or storage of blood samples can lead to inaccurate Test Results, which can have serious implications for patient diagnosis and treatment.
  2. Patient Safety: Ensuring the integrity of blood samples is critical to patient safety, as incorrect Test Results can lead to incorrect diagnoses and ineffective treatments.
  3. Compliance with Regulations: Medical laboratories are required to adhere to strict Regulations and Quality Control standards to ensure the accuracy and reliability of Test Results.

Best Practices for Handling and Storage of Blood Samples

1. Following Established Protocols and Guidelines

One of the first and most crucial steps in ensuring proper handling and storage of blood samples is to follow established protocols and guidelines. These protocols outline the proper procedures for collecting, handling, and storing blood samples to ensure their integrity and accuracy. Laboratory staff should be trained on these protocols and adhere to them consistently.

2. Maintaining Proper Temperature Conditions

Proper temperature conditions are critical for preserving the integrity of blood samples. Most blood samples need to be kept at a specific temperature range to prevent degradation and ensure accurate Test Results. Refrigeration or freezing may be required for certain types of samples, so it is essential to have the appropriate storage facilities available.

3. Using Appropriate Storage Containers

Choosing the right storage containers for blood samples is essential to prevent contamination or damage. These containers should be clean, sterile, and designed to maintain the stability of the samples. Using the wrong type of container or storing samples improperly can compromise the integrity of the samples and lead to inaccurate Test Results.

Ensuring Quality Control Measures

Implementing Quality Control measures is essential for maintaining the highest standards in blood Sample Handling and storage. Quality Control measures help identify any issues or Discrepancies in the handling or storage of samples before they impact Test Results. Some Quality Control measures include:

  1. Regular monitoring of storage conditions, such as temperature and humidity levels
  2. Verification of sample identification and labeling to prevent mix-ups
  3. Routine calibration and maintenance of equipment used for sample storage

Training and Education of Laboratory Staff

Proper training and education of laboratory staff are essential for ensuring the proper handling and storage of blood samples. All staff members should be trained on the correct procedures for collecting, handling, and storing blood samples. Regular training sessions and refresher courses can help reinforce these procedures and ensure that staff members are up-to-date on the latest protocols and guidelines.

Maintaining Accurate Record-Keeping Practices

Accurate record-keeping is crucial for tracking the handling and storage of blood samples. Detailed records should be kept of when samples were collected, who collected them, how they were handled and stored, and when they were used for testing. These records help ensure traceability and accountability in the event of any Discrepancies or issues with the samples.
